    uw0tm8. If you have Windows installed on an SSD, you can load up your browser with 500 shyt plugins and still have it run faster than a vanilla browser on a mechanical drive.

    Btw, a video games framerate relies directly on the processing power of both the CPU and GPU. Framerate has nothing to do with hard drive speed or RAM. The only things those can help is loading times.

    You're not going to get more FPS from turning off background applications. Maybe a frame or two.

    Something that WOULD however effect fps is something like a running video, or if you're rendering a video / converting songs as it uses the CPU for processing power taking away from the game. But a browser? Gooby pls.
